Because while several GOP states already have exemptions for rape, incest, and the life of the mother, they way the laws are written, an abortion under any of those exemptions is almost unobtainable. because there are draconian restrictions on the exemptions, and threats against both the woman as well as healthcare providers for non compliance.

Let’s take rape and incest exemptions first, since they’re so similar. In most cases, if a woman wants a rape exemption, she is required to file a police report at the time, and get a rape kit from an emergency room to confirm her claim. The same is pretty much true for incest. The problem is that the vast majority of women don’t immediately report rape or incest out of purely personal reasons, including shock. But in these states, if you don’t follow the rules, you’re shit out of luck. And many of them provide sanctions that if a medical provider believes the woman, and provide the abortion, they are subject to potential imprisonment and hefty fines.   5. Don’t forget also that a lot of abortion clinics also have to face STRUCTURAL hurdles. There have been states that have required the providers to have “admitting privileges” to local hospitals in the (rare) event that something goes wrong during or just after the procedure and with many states making it difficult for there to even be local providers, many providers have to travel (kind of like the old “circuit riders” system for judges) and, because they’re not truly “local,” they’re rarely ever able to gain those privileges.
    Then there are the states that actually mandate abortion clinics to adhere to the same requirements as full hospitals (with regards to such things as the width of interior doors, the size of storage areas, the exact temperature of the rooms where the procedure is done, etc).
